Report Cards

Your child's second quarter report card was sent home today. Please review the report card with your child. Overall, the children are doing very well, and we are pleased with their progress. If you have any questions or concerns about your child's progress, please do not hesitate to contact your child's teacher or Mr. Kane.

Our goal is to see each child achieve at the highest limits of his or her potential. This takes time, practice, patience, and making good choices. As a general rule, the high achieving student makes the following choices:
  • Limiting television, video games, and non-academic computer time.
  • Spend 2X as much time reading as the above mentioned activities. That's 2 hours of reading for every hour of TV or video games.
  • Always comes to class prepared and with homework assignments completed.
  • Asks questions in class if he or she does not understand something.
  • Always pays attention in class, does not distract others, nor is he or she easily distracted.
  • Writes all assignments, tests, project due dates and other school related activities in his or her planner (Grades 3-8).
  • Older students as for appointments with their teachers for extra help when needed. They do not wait for the test results.
These skills are life-learning skills. We want our students to develop these positive work habits beginning at a young age. Many of these skills are taught and reinforced at school, but some must be monitored at home. As partners in education, we will continue to work together for the strong development of your child.
